20/06/03 晴 38℃/24℃
习惯孤独后,一个人便是全世界。
今天来分享一下刚学的python中数据可视化常用的一个第三方库,也是号称“python四剑客”之一的matplotlib库。
一,先导入一些所需要的库
import matplotlib.pyplot as plt
import matplotlib
import pandas as pd
import numpy as np
import random
plt.rcParams['font.sans-serif']=['SimHei'] # 用黑体显示中文
plt.rcParams['axes.unicode_minus']=False # 正常显示负号
二,绘制散点图
x = np.arange(1,10,0.5)
y = x**2+1
plt.scatter(x,y,color='r')
plt.show()
效果如图:
三,曲线图
plt.plot(x,y)#这里的数据还是引用上面的
plt.show()
效果如图:
三,条形图
x_data=('A','B','C','D','E')
y4,y5=[],[]
for i in range(5):
y4.append(random.randint(20,50))
y5.append(random.randint(20,